freepeople性欧美熟妇, 色戒完整版无删减158分钟hd, 无码精品国产vα在线观看DVD, 丰满少妇伦精品无码专区在线观看,艾栗栗与纹身男宾馆3p50分钟,国产AV片在线观看,黑人与美女高潮,18岁女RAPPERDISSSUBS,国产手机在机看影片

正文內容

畢業(yè)論文-基于微加速度計的無線鼠標設計(已修改)

2025-01-28 22:42 本頁面
 

【正文】 基于 微 加速度計的無線鼠標 設計 學 院: 機械與電氣工程 專 業(yè): 電氣工程及其自動化 隊 長: 隊 員: 指導教師: 摘 要 本設計針對傳統(tǒng)鼠標只能 在桌面上使用 的不足,設計出一種基于微加速度計的無線鼠標,它不僅具有教學激光筆上下翻頁的功能,而且能在空中依靠 鼠標的偏轉角度實現(xiàn) 電腦 桌面光標的移動、 鼠標點擊的功能,本設計 以 微加速度計 ADXL345 作為信號檢測元件,并采用低功耗低成本微控制器 STC15L2K60S2和RF 芯片 nRF24L01進行信息處理與無線傳輸, 通過 HT82M98A處理后將信息傳給計算機,計算機自動完成相應動作。 關鍵詞:微加速度計;無線鼠標;低功耗 目錄 總體結構框圖 ........................................................ 1 系統(tǒng)軟件設計 ........................................................ 1 方案比較 ............................................................ 3 控制器的選擇 .................................................. 3 微加速度計選擇 ................................................ 3 無線模塊的選擇 ................................................ 3 二、單元模塊設計 ............................................................ 4 電路的設計 .......................................................... 4 遠端控制子系統(tǒng)硬件電路設計 .................................... 4 主機端信號接收系統(tǒng)電路設計 .................................... 6 軟件的設計 .......................................................... 6 ADXL345 微加速 度計模塊程序設計 ................................ 6 HT82M98A 鼠標控制器程序設計 ................................... 7 nRF24L01 無線模塊程序設計 ..................................... 7 三、系統(tǒng)調試 ................................................................ 7 四、設計總結 ................................................................ 8 參考文獻 .................................................................... 8 附錄 ........................................................................ 8 ................................................ 8 主機端接收電路原理圖 ................................................. 9 1 一、總體方案設計 總體 結構框圖 本系統(tǒng)主要由 無線鼠標發(fā)射器、單片機控制系統(tǒng)、無線鼠標接收器和接收系統(tǒng)識別 組成 。 (a)遠端控制 子系統(tǒng)結構 框圖 (b)主機端信號 接收系統(tǒng)結構 框圖 圖 11 系統(tǒng)框圖 系統(tǒng) 軟件設計 ( a) 遠端控制 子 系統(tǒng) 程序流程 遠端控制用微加速度計獲取鼠標的移動信息,每隔 5ms掃描一次。 PC機 無線接收 單片機 按鍵單元 無線發(fā)射 微加速度計 單片機 震動開關 2 圖 12遠端控制 子 系統(tǒng) 程序流程 圖 ( b) 主機端信號 接收系統(tǒng) 程序 流程 接收電路的主要任務是接收無線鼠標傳送的各種數(shù)據(jù)。接收程序中一次循環(huán)所需的時間大約為 。 必須確保在下一個數(shù)據(jù)包傳來之前,完成全部算法及相應處理工作。同時也避免新收到的數(shù)據(jù)包覆蓋前一個數(shù)據(jù)包。 圖 13主機端信號 接收系統(tǒng) 程序 流程 圖 3 方案比較 控制器的 選擇 方案一:采用 、自由度大,功耗低、體積小、技術成熟等優(yōu)點,得到了廣泛應用 . 但是 51單片內部資源有限,給系統(tǒng)設計過程帶來不便。且影響系統(tǒng)控制等各個環(huán)節(jié),不便于實時調控。 方案二:采用 89C52的優(yōu)點 ,且具有 89C52所不具備的一些性能,可不接外部晶振和外部復位電路,使硬件設計更簡單;大容量 2K字節(jié) SRAM;有兩個獨立串口;內部有 8通道高速 10位 A/D轉換器 ,還具有 PWM輸出;總的來說, STC15F2K60S2是一種高速,高可靠性,超低功耗的性能更好的單片機。 綜合以上二種方案,選擇方案二。 微加速度計 選擇 方案一:采用 Freescale公司生產(chǎn)的 MMA7455L數(shù)字輸出 ( IIC/SPI) 微電容調節(jié)式加速度感應芯片 [ 1] 。MMA7455L具有 X、 Y、 Z 三個方向的感應軸, X、 Y、 Z 三個方向上在工作時的參數(shù)是不斷變化的,代表這一瞬間該芯片在不同方向上移動的趨勢,這三個參數(shù)通過簡單的數(shù)學計算可以得到一個空間向量 A,向量 A 即模擬出了該瞬間芯片在三維真實空間的移動方向,這樣,通過不斷地采集 X、 Y、 Z的數(shù)值,就可以得到鼠標移動的真實軌跡。 方案二:采用 ADXL345三軸數(shù)字加速度傳感器, ADXL345 是 ADI 公司的三軸數(shù)字加速度傳感器, 工作原理是首先由前端感應器件感測加速度的大小,然后由感應電信號器件轉為可識別的模擬電信號,ADXL345中集成了 AD 轉換器,可以將此模擬信號數(shù)字化,輸出的是 16 位的二進制補碼。最值得一提的它集成了一個 32級先進先出 (FIFO)存儲器管理系統(tǒng),可用于輸出數(shù)據(jù)的緩沖,降低主機處理器負荷,并降低整體系統(tǒng)功耗。該芯片主要應用于消費電子的微型慣性器件, 最大可感知177。 16 g 的加速度 ,感應精度可達 mg /LSB,傾角測量典型誤差小于 1176。 ,超低功耗。通過其內置的 ADC 將加速度信號轉換為數(shù)字量存放在片內緩 沖區(qū),在實際使用中,為提高輸出數(shù)據(jù)的穩(wěn)定性 ,設置感應范圍為 177。 2 g,感應精度為 mg,可以滿足人體動作加速度范圍與精度要求。 ADXL345可以通過 SPI 總線或 I2C 總線與單片機連接,本產(chǎn)品選擇的單片機 STC15F2K60S2 I2C 接口, 但是可以采用 I/O 口模擬 I2C總線或 SPI 總線接口的方法連接。 綜合以上二種方案, 方案二功耗更低,更容易 實現(xiàn) ,故選 之 。 無線 模塊的選擇 在幾種短距離無線通信的比較當中 ,紅外方案有一定的方向性 ,而藍牙技術比較復雜 ,價格比較高 ,而無線射頻通信技術無 論是從系統(tǒng)開銷,電池壽命還是成本方面都占有很大優(yōu)勢 ,同時它低傳輸速率的特點 ,恰恰適合發(fā)送信息量非常小的無線鼠標設計。 nRF24L01無線射頻模塊是一款新型單片射頻收發(fā)器件 , 工作于 GHzISM 頻段,最高工作速率達 2 Mbps,信號空中傳輸時間很短,極大降低了無線傳輸中的碰撞現(xiàn)象和電流消耗
點擊復制文檔內容
法律信息相關推薦
文庫吧 www.dybbs8.com
公安備案圖鄂ICP備17016276號-1